- BlueZ 5 v5.3 experimental new package;
- bluez5 package does not replace bluez4 package,
as a lot of components that interact with bluez
are not prepared to work correctly with bluez5;
- bluez5 is not an upgrade path from bluez4.
- bluez5 conflicts with/replaces bluez4.

The logic was that if a *distro* does the upgrade from bluez4 to
bluez5, the package manager needs to be able to remove bluez4 when
installing bluez5, as otherwise they'd just conflict and the package
manager would error out.

I'll admit that I didn't test an upgrade path, but the scenario I can
see actually happening is that the distro flips its applications from
bluez4 to bluez5 so they rdepend on bluez5 now. bluez5 will get
pulled in through that dependency, nothing depends on bluez4 anymore,
so opkg should remove bluez4. bluez4 and bluez5 don't expose the same
ABI so they are not suitable RPROVIDES for eachother.

Hello all,
Initial status:
QEmu machine core-image-sato.
Follow the /update/upgrade/install path as below:
Fact: bluez5, at this point, is not an upgrade path for bluez4.
Logical conclusion would be that bluez 5 and bluez4 should be provided only with RCONFLICTS (case 2), so that doing an:
opkg upgrade
would not work, otherwise, user will conclude that, at this stage, bluez5 is a replacement for bluez4, which, simply, is not true (Case 1).
Forcing user to remove bluez4 and install manually bluez5 will suggest that bluez5 is not compatible with bluez4, so not a replacement.
In conclusion, in my opinion, we should go with RCONFLICTS only for bluez5.3 PU.
See cases below.
Please advise.

Case 2 shows that if some distribution makes decision to replace bluez4
with bluez5 (e.g. doesn't have ofono, connman,
packagegroup-base-bluetooth in their images, only their own app adapted
to use bluez5), then they need to add RREPLACES to bluez4 by .bbappend.
That's why I was complaining about "upgrade path" when someone makes
decision to change bluez version.
On the other hand, having whole R* combo in bluez5 can cause issues to
people who don't want to upgrade yet (like in Case 1) - one answer to
that is that they just shouldn't build it (no bluez5 in binary feed
should prevent accidental opkg upgrade), but this works only until
someone does e.g. "bitbake world" :/.
